What Affects Home Insurance Rates in Galveston, Texas?

The home insurance rates in Galveston, Texas, are shaped by various factors, all of which contribute to the risk assessment conducted by insurers. Here are the primary influences:

1. Location and Weather Risks

Galveston is prone to specific weather conditions, particularly hurricanes and flooding, which significantly affect insurance rates. Homes situated in high-risk areas often face elevated premiums due to the increased likelihood of claims.

2. Home Characteristics

The size, age, and condition of your home play a critical role in determining your insurance rates. For instance:

  • Size: Larger homes typically require higher coverage limits, thus leading to higher premiums.
  • Age: Older homes may have outdated electrical, plumbing, or roofing systems, increasing the risk of damage and claims.
  • Construction Materials: Homes built with fire-resistant materials often attract lower rates because they pose a lesser risk to insurers.

3. Coverage Options and Deductibles

Your choice of coverage options and deductibles will also influence your home insurance rates. Higher deductibles generally mean lower premiums, but also increase your out-of-pocket costs in the event of a claim.

4. Claims History

If you have a history of filing insurance claims, you may face higher rates. Insurers view frequent claims as an indicator of risk, impacting your premiums.

5. Credit Score

Surprisingly, your credit score can also affect your home insurance rates. Insurers often use credit scores as a predictor of future claims, meaning a lower score could lead to higher rates.

How to Get the Best Home Insurance Rates in Galveston, Texas

1. Shop Around

It’s essential to compare quotes from different insurers. Each company uses its own underwriting criteria, and you may find significant differences in premiums for the same level of coverage.

2. Bundle Your Policies

Many insurers offer discounts if you bundle multiple policies, such as home and auto insurance. This can lead to substantial savings on your overall insurance costs.

3. Improve Your Home's Safety Features

Installing security systems, fire alarms, and other safety features can lead to discounts on your insurance premiums. Insurers appreciate homes that are less likely to suffer damage or theft.

4. Maintain a Good Credit Score

Working to improve and maintain a good credit score can significantly influence your insurance rates. Responsible financial behavior can lead to lower premiums over time.

5. Review Your Coverage Regularly

Your needs may change over time, so it’s vital to review your policy annually. Adjusting your coverage limits and updating your policy can help ensure you’re getting the best deal possible.

The Role of Hurricane Insurance in Galveston

Given Galveston’s coastal location and susceptibility to hurricanes, it’s crucial to understand the role of hurricane insurance within your overall home insurance policy. Standard policies often exclude hurricane winds and flood coverage, making it important to assess additional policies or endorsements.

1. Separate Windstorm Coverage

In Texas, many homeowners need separate windstorm insurance. This insurance is specifically designed to cover damages caused by vehicle storms and is usually obtained through the Texas Windstorm Insurance Association (TWIA) for properties located in designated areas.

2. Flood Insurance

Flooding is a real threat in Galveston, especially during hurricanes. Standard policies typically do not include flood coverage, so it’s vital to consider purchasing a flood insurance policy through the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) or other private insurers.
